Cambridge Muslim College is a registered Islamic charity and independent higher education institution located in Cambridge, UK. The College seeks a Development Manager to lead its fundraising and donor engagement strategy as it enters a phase of long-term sustainability and major donor growth.

Role Overview

This is a permanent, full-time position (or 0.8 FTE part-time available) on a hybrid basis with approximately two days per week in the Cambridge office.

Key Responsibilities

  • Develop and execute the College's comprehensive fundraising and donor engagement strategy across multiple income streams
  • Build and manage relationships with major donors and high-net-worth individuals, including prospect identification and cultivation
  • Lead structured fundraising campaigns with compelling cases for support
  • Expand major donor engagement beyond the Ramadan period to achieve consistent year-round giving
  • Grow the Friends and Patrons regular-giving programme
  • Develop corporate partnerships and explore international giving opportunities
  • Enhance fundraising systems, processes, and donor stewardship practices
  • Oversee communications and digital engagement aligned with fundraising priorities
  • Mentor and manage a small development team (Development Coordinator and Communications Coordinator)
  • Represent the College at donor events, with willingness to travel internationally as needed

Required Qualifications & Experience

  • Proven track record in multi-stream fundraising including major donor fundraising
  • Demonstrated success securing significant five-figure or six-figure gifts from high-net-worth donors
  • Experience in either corporate giving or regular giving programmes
  • Strong relationship-building and networking skills
  • Expertise in crafting cases for support and delivering structured donor stewardship
  • Demonstrable experience engaging with Muslim communities
  • Understanding of Islamic charitable giving practices, including Zakat and Sadaqah
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Team leadership experience

Desirable Experience

  • Corporate or alumni fundraising background
  • Experience running appeals or donor campaigns

Benefits

  • Salary: Β£50,000–£55,000 per annum
  • 5% employer pension contribution
  • 28 days annual leave plus UK bank holidays and two additional Eid days
  • Free home-cooked lunches during term time
